#478c72 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#478c72 is composed of 27.8% red, 54.9%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 18.6% yellow and 45.1% black. It has a hue angle of 157.4 degrees, a saturation of 32.7% and a lightness of 41.4%. #478c72 color hex could be obtained by blending #8effe4 with #001900.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#478c72 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#478c72 has RGB values of R:71, G:140, B:114 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0, Y:0.19,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 4689010.

Shades and Tints of #478c72
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050a08 is the darkest color, while #fcfd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#478c72
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#676c6a is the less saturated color, while #06cd82 is the most saturated one.
